Address

RoL8fPvzfmmjrdSWFUdzkezakdcZkbdG8W

0 RDD

Confirmed
Total Received27767.39000000 RDD1.17 USD
Total Sent27767.39000000 RDD1.17 USD
Final Balance0 RDD0.00 USD
No. Transactions2

Transactions

RoL8fPvzfmmjrdSWFUdzkezakdcZkbdG8W27767.39000000 RDD0.27 USD1.17 USD
 
Rvae2pfgk3umNCNscs1FTVPhL38UB7x6rY128.00000000 RDD0.00 USD0.01 USD
Rg5iuxvz4kGrtjs6b9Vonah4mVtEyTgT9527639.29000000 RDD0.27 USD1.16 USD
RsRn5SRxz6KuNzH8EW4ehXhZWbdiAkAcB727907.49000000 RDD0.27 USD1.17 USD
 
RoL8fPvzfmmjrdSWFUdzkezakdcZkbdG8W27767.39000000 RDD0.27 USD1.17 USD
RwVQnTNr9R3ew4QW19A4g1WT6PZdbKkVPG140.00000000 RDD0.00 USD0.01 USD